When choosing your new windows look at their energy efficiency ratings as well as their solar heat gain coefficient (SHGCw). The latter is a value between 0 and 1 . It measures how effectively a window regulates heat transfer from the sun.

A high SHGCw is when the window will let in more heat than it needs to, whereas a low one will help keep your home cool and reduce the cost of heating. Double glazing must be certified to comply with this standard.

As opposed to single-glazed windows glazing is characterized by a space between the panes which can be filled with air or gas like argon. This can help increase the insulation of your home and lower the amount of energy it uses.

Double-glazed windows are also incredibly efficient in keeping heat in your home. This makes them a preferred choice for homeowners who want to increase their energy efficiency.

Picking a glazier with an established track record is crucial. Check out their credentials, for instance, UPVC windows whether they're registered with FENSA (Fenestration Self-Assessment Scheme), FMB (Federation of Master Builders), or TrustMark. Also, ask for photos of previous work, so that you can be certain that they're experienced and Upvc windows know what they're doing.

You should also consider the materials you use for your window frames. Certain kinds of frames like aluminium require minimal maintenance and don't require staining or painting. However, wooden frames can be susceptible to warping and rotting and could require more attention.
